What the bloomin heck's this all about?! I bought a Jag not a Bugatti. How am I supposed to get anyuse out of this "service". I cant afford anything they have to offer.
Examples in the latest newsletter:
Diner des Tsars - An 8 course menu at Guildhall by Tom Aikens, followed by music from Katherine Jenkins. Only £15k per table (+VAT!).
World Cup cricket - A weeks accom, plus tickets for 3 matches. Tickets START at £10k.
Gumball - A place in this years Gumball for £28k.
Property share offering 5weeks holdiay a year for a mere £150k.
Plus other things like an expedition to the North Pole (god knows how much that'll be).
I thought that they were going to offer me freebies and some discounts off normal stuff. Good job it was a free service for one year.

The Q service is not ALL stuff of this price level. I've been a member for a few years and it's proved useful. it's more about opening doors than saving money in my experience. 24/7 you can phone Q to get otherwise impossible tickets and tables and more often that not penetrate otherwise inpenetrable club door policies. You can just phone them and they'll get you what you want. Perhaps the best thing they sorted out for me was a weekend in Paris. It was very short notice and I was particular about what I wanted. The weekend in question Paris Fashion Week, the motor show and something else were on - everything worth booking in the centre of Paris was taken (the best one of my colleagues could manage with Octopus or something was half an hour away by train). Q got me what I wanted and if Q makes the booking, the places you go try that bit harder to ensure you're delighted.
I'm quite intrigued by the opportunity to see Bill Clinton in New York having never seen/met a US president. £280 or £550 (exc. flights!) a head doesn't sound mad and you can be assured the red carpet will be out. As I understand it, you get the email newsletter with Q Jaguar - worth a look IMO.
Their top level of Membership costs an eye-watering £25K/year and the likes of Jemima Khan etc. are, I believe, in that crowd. (I'm not!)
